Instant Pot® Vegan Split Pea Soup

INGREDIENTS

  • Base

    • 1 tablespoon olive oil
    • 6 cups vegetable broth
  • Vegetables

    • 🧅 1 medium onion, chopped
    • 🧄 2 cloves garlic, minced
    • 🥔 1 pound red potatoes, chopped
    • 🥕 2 medium carrots, peeled and sliced
  • Legumes

    • 1 pound dried split peas
  • Seasonings

    • 2 teaspoons liquid smoke flavoring
    • 1 teaspoon dried thyme leaves
    • ¼ teaspoon crushed red pepper flakes
    • 1 large bay leaf
    • salt and freshly ground black pepper to taste

STEPS

1

Turn on a multi-functional pressure cooker (such as Instant Pot®) and select Saute function. Add olive oil and onion. Cook until soft and translucent, about 4 minutes. Add garlic and cook until fragrant, about 1 minute. Cancel Saute function.

2

Add split peas, potatoes, carrots, liquid smoke, thyme, pepper flakes, bay leaf, salt, and pepper; stir to combine. Pour in vegetable broth and mix to combine. Close and lock the lid. Select high pressure according to manufacturer's instructions; set timer for 12 minutes. Allow 20 minutes for pressure to build.

3

Release pressure using the natural-release method according to manufacturer's instructions, about 10 minutes. Remove lid, stir, adjust salt and pepper to taste, and let sit for 5 minutes to thicken.

💡 This soup thickens as it rests; add water or broth to loosen if necessary.Use smoked paprika instead of liquid smoke for a different flavor profile.Great as a meal prep option—store in airtight containers in the fridge for up to 5 days.
